Well, take it with a grain of salt.  I have no actual knowledge of what IBM
was attempting or what really happened.  But from where I sat the evidence
was pretty compelling: they wanted an OpenSolaris port enough to give us
some hypervisor changes we asked for (which certainly must have had
substantial engineering costs for them), and it was pretty clear to me at
the time that Sun was looking for a buyer and that IBM would be a natural
entity to buy them.
